What People Are Saying About Take-Two Interactive Software

  • Time Off Access: Company materials highlight generous PTO, paid holidays and sick days, and company‑wide breaks at some labels. Feedback suggests many employees can take time when needed.
  • Wellbeing Programs: The organization offers mental health resources via EAP and counseling, alongside fitness initiatives and family wellbeing support in certain locations. These programs indicate sustained investment in employee health.
  • Burnout Prevention: Senior leadership frames schedule delays on flagship titles as a way to avoid crunch and burnout. Longer development windows and strong funding are cited as mechanisms to reduce last‑minute surges.
